When NOT to use AgentGPT

  • Avoid using if your project requires a NoSQL database solution, given that AgentGPT is configured specifically with MySQL out-of-the-box
  • Consider alternatives if your stack does not include FastAPI or Next.js, as the tool's default configurations might require significant adjustment
